Structure of a New Software Request Email

Break down the email into its core components. Explain each part clearly.

1. The Subject Line

The subject line is the first thing recipients see, making it critical for immediate understanding and prioritization. It should be clear, concise, and indicate the email's purpose.

  • Formula:[Action/Purpose] - [Specific Request/Topic] or Request for [Software Name/Type]

2. The Salutation

The salutation sets the tone. Use a formal greeting for professional settings, especially when addressing someone you don't know well or a superior.

  • Formal: "Dear [Mr./Ms./Dr. Last Name]," or "Dear [Team Name],"
  • Informal (use with caution): "Hi [First Name]," (only if you have an established, informal relationship)

3. The Body

The body paragraphs contain the core message, ensuring all necessary information is conveyed logically and persuasively for your New Software Request email.

  • Opening: Start by clearly stating the email's purpose without delay. Immediately inform the recipient that this is a software request, setting the expectation for the rest of your message.
  • Key Details: Provide essential background information, such as the specific problem the software aims to solve, why this particular software is the optimal solution, and any relevant departmental or project context. Include detailed specifics about its expected features or the benefits it will bring, such as increased efficiency or cost savings. This section is crucial for building a strong justification.
  • The "Ask" or Main Point: Clearly articulate what you are requesting. This could be approval for purchase, an opportunity for a trial period, or a meeting to discuss implementation. Make the desired action unambiguous, guiding the recipient on the next steps.
  • Closing Remarks: Briefly reiterate your request or offer further information. Express gratitude for their time and careful consideration of your software request. Emphasize your availability for any follow-up questions.

4. The Closing and Signature

This provides a professional end to your email.

  • Appropriate Closing Phrases: "Sincerely," "Regards," "Best regards," "Yours faithfully" (if you used "Dear Sir/Madam").
  • Signature: Include your full name, title, department, and contact information.

Essential Vocabulary

Crafting an effective email, especially a New Software Request email, requires precise vocabulary. Using the right words demonstrates professionalism and clarity, as emphasized in guides for effective business communication like those from Purdue OWL.

VocabularyMeaningExample
StreamlineTo make a process more efficient and simple."This software will help us streamline our data entry."
EnhanceTo improve the quality, value, or extent of something."We believe this tool will enhance team collaboration."
JustificationA good reason for something existing or being done."The justification for this request is increased productivity."
ImplementTo put a decision, plan, or agreement into effect."We aim to implement the new system by next quarter."
Trial periodA period during which a new product or service is tested."Could we arrange a trial period to evaluate its suitability?"
Seamless integrationThe smooth and efficient merging of systems."It offers seamless integration with our existing platforms."
Allocate resourcesTo distribute or designate assets or personnel."We need to ensure we can allocate resources for training."
PrioritizeTo determine the order for dealing with a series of tasks or projects."We need to prioritize this software given its impact."
FeasibilityThe possibility that something can be done easily or conveniently."We are assessing the feasibility of this software purchase."

Email Example

Here is an example of a New Software Request email, demonstrating how to apply the structural components and vocabulary discussed. This template is designed for a scenario where a department is requesting a new project management tool.


Subject: Request for Approval: [Software Name] Project Management Tool

Dear Mr. Johnson,

I am writing to formally request approval for the purchase of [Software Name], a project management software designed to enhance our team's workflow and collaboration. This tool has been identified as a solution to streamline our current project tracking processes and improve overall efficiency.

Our current methods involve manual updates and disparate spreadsheets, leading to inconsistencies and delays. After thorough research, we believe [Software Name] offers a comprehensive suite of features, including task automation, real-time reporting, and seamless integration with our existing communication platforms, that will address these challenges directly. The justification for this request lies in its potential to significantly boost productivity and reduce project delivery times.

We are seeking approval for the annual subscription of [Software Name] for our team of 15 members, at a cost of [$X per year]. We would also appreciate the opportunity for a trial period if available, to fully assess its feasibility within our specific environment.

Thank you for considering this request. I am available at your convenience to discuss this further and provide any additional information you may require.

Best regards,

[Your Full Name] [Your Title] [Your Department] [Your Contact Information]
